A real cross-section of Richmond and beyond returns here for quality menu hits and the standards you expect from a food truck.
The tacos de asada are a can't-go-wrong classic and I appreciate the mix of carrots, radishes, onions and peppers that complement each dish. Fully eat the quesadillas while they are warm; don't save to reheat this selection, as it's cheese is much better freshly cooked. The quesabirrias hit the spot for me, too! I like the horchata the best of the aguafrescas that are all refreshing and not overly sweet. I like the doradito light-browning of some of the food selections, and the salsas are very tasty - I like the green sauce the best.
The staff members are keen to make the food as you like it and aim to get your meals to you with efficiency and a smile. They care!
Many people return here from what I've witnessed. The corner can be a bit windy on the straightaway from Civic Center to the West, but on a sunny day it can be great to borrow part of the bench and table to eat by the tropically-colored and decorated food truck. Some people choose to carefully dine in their cars for warmth, too, somewhat like a drive-up diner.
My friends and family and I will see you at La Alma de Sol!
